Great Plains ADA Center Salary

As of August 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Great Plains ADA Center in the United States is $83,688.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$40. Salaries at Great Plains ADA Center typically range from $73,180 to $95,759 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

About Great Plains ADA Center
The Great Plains ADA Center provides basic to advanced level workshops on all areas covered by the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A). These workshops can be specifically tailored to the needs and time constraints of your group or organization. What Is the Cost of Living Near Columbia?

Understanding the cost of living near Columbia is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Great Plains ADA Center.
Columbia's Cost of Living Index is approximately 87.9 (12.1% less expensive than US average; 1.2% less than MO average). Home to Univ. of Missouri, affordable housing. Go COMO bus. When planning your budget based on a salary from Great Plains ADA Center, consider these typical monthly expenses:
